Odds are, you are a person looking for a real estate property and have concluded that now may be the right time to buy!  It is clear that the number of Delaware real estate listings has increased dramatically as compared to the amount of sales in the last few years.  In some cases, this has resulted in opportunities to purchase homes at prices lower than prior years. 

But, does this make every deal the best and most cost effective?  Unfortunately, no.  Sellers of existing homes often are facing difficult situations that make negotiations tricky.  New home builders may have reduced prices.  However, neither they nor their agents, whether a seller’s realtor or builder’s representative, can focus exclusively on your needs, goals, and dreams.  This is true because they are hired to represent the seller’s interest.

 

It is critical that you find a realtor that will be an advocate for you in your purchase of Delaware real estate – one that can help you find the best value to meet your needs.  The Real Estate Buyer’s Agent Council (REBAC) explains that a buyer’s representative has your best interests in mind throughout the entire real estate process and will:

• Evaluate your specific needs and wants and locate properties that fit those specifications. 

• Research the selected properties to identify any problems or issues to help you make an informed decision prior to making an offer to purchase the property. 

• Negotiate on your behalf to help obtain the identified property -- keeping your best interests in mind. 

• Most importantly, fully-represent YOU throughout the real estate transaction.

Look for a realtor with the Accredited Buyer’s Representative (ABR) designation.  Why? These three letters after a REALTOR's name tell you that you will be working with a buyer representative who is committed to your best interests. The ABR Designation is awarded by REBAC to those REALTORS who have met the specific educational and experiential criteria needed to provide the high level quality service required by REBAC.  More details can be found at http://www.rebac.net.
